摘要
考虑一个双曲抛物系统的初边值问题,当动能函数为非线性函数且初始值的H^2范数任意大时,得到了全局光滑解的存在性和指数稳定性.这些结果推广了以前相关的结果,因为以前相关的结果都是关于线性的动能函数或者初始值的H^2范数充分小的情形.
The initial boundary value problem for a generalized hyperbolic-parabolic system was considered. When nonlinear kinetics and smooth initial data which have small L2 -norm energy, may have arbitrarily large H2-norm energy, existence and exponential stability of global smooth solutions were obtained. These results generalize previous related results on smooth solutions for kinetic function being linear or H2-norm of the initial data being sufficiently small.
